Wakame is an edible seaweed originally native to cold temperate coastal areas of Japan, Korea, and China. Sea farmers in these areas are the main producers and eaters as well of wakame. In Japan, it is a common ingredient in miso soup. It is interesting to note also that the people of these countries have been hailed to have very healthy skin in spite of old age.

Phytessence wakame, an extract from the seaweed wakame, is now used as an ingredient in skin care.
